当前位置:首页 > 教程攻略 > 正文

优化软件排行榜单更新与性能提升实用技巧解析

以下是为您撰写的技术文档,围绕“优化软件排行”展开,结合用途、使用说明及配置要求等多维度分析,满足1500-250需求,并通过小标题结构化呈现:

优化软件排行技术解析与应用指南

作者:资深软件工程师

日期:2025年5月4日

1. 优化软件分类与核心用途

1.1 系统级优化工具

系统级优化软件专注于提升操作系统及底层资源的运行效率,常见于优化软件排行的性能工具前列。典型代表包括:

  • 内存管理工具:通过动态分配策略和内存池技术减少碎片,降低访问延迟。
  • CPU调度工具:优化进程调度算法,提升多线程任务处理能力。
  • I/O与网络优化工具:调整数据读写策略与网络协议栈参数,减少延迟。
  • 用途示例:UG软件优化方案中,通过调整图形设置(如透明度与阴影)提升渲染速度。

    1.2 代码与算法优化工具

    此类工具聚焦于代码结构与算法的改进,常见于开发工具排行。例如:

  • 代码复杂度分析工具:通过圈复杂度评估与重构建议,提升可维护性。
  • 算法调优工具:优化时间与空间复杂度,如利用并行计算加速处理。
  • 性能分析器:定位代码瓶颈,支持实时调优。
  • 典型场景:3ds Max通过多线程技术与GPU加速,显著提升三维渲染效率。

    1.3 应用性能管理(APM)工具

    APM工具在优化软件排行中占据重要地位,主要用于监控与分析应用运行状态:

  • 全链路跟踪:识别系统拓扑中的性能瓶颈。
  • 资源利用率监控:实时分析CPU、内存及网络负载。
  • 异常告警与日志管理:快速定位故障并提供修复建议。
  • 2. 使用说明与操作指南

    2.1 系统优化工具操作流程

    1. 数据采集:使用性能分析器(如Windows性能监视器)收集系统资源数据。

    2. 瓶颈识别:通过拓扑分析确定高负载模块(如内存泄漏或CPU争用)。

    3. 策略实施

  • 内存优化:启用动态分配与缓存预热。
  • I/O优化:合并批量请求并采用CDN加速。
  • 2.2 代码优化最佳实践

  • 重构技术:提取重复代码为独立函数,合并冗余逻辑。
  • 数据结构选择:根据场景选用数组(索引访问)或链表(频繁增删)。
  • 并行化处理:通过协程与多线程技术提升并发性能。
  • 示例:Tinder通过优化“约会应用”等通用关键词,显著提升搜索排名。

    2.3 APM工具配置步骤

    1. 环境部署:安装Agent至目标服务器并配置采集频率。

    2. 指标定义:设置响应时间、错误率等关键性能指标。

    3. 告警规则:定义阈值并集成通知渠道(如邮件或Slack)。

    3. 配置要求与硬件适配

    3.1 CPU与内存需求

  • 高性能计算场景:推荐Intel i9或AMD Ryzen 9处理器,搭配32GB以上内存。
  • 开发与测试环境:至少Intel i5处理器与16GB内存。
  • 3.2 存储与显卡选择

  • 存储优化:采用NVMe SSD提升I/O吞吐量,单独安装优化软件以减少延迟。
  • 图形处理:3D渲染工具需配置NVIDIA RTX系列或AMD Radeon Pro显卡。
  • 3.3 操作系统与依赖环境

  • 兼容性:确保工具支持当前系统版本(如Windows 11或Linux Kernel 6.x)。
  • 依赖库:安装.NET Framework、Java Runtime等基础环境。
  • 4. 优化策略与排名提升要点

    4.1 性能调优方法论

  • 负载均衡:动态分配资源以避免单点过载。
  • 缓存策略:采用LRU算法与分布式缓存减少数据库压力。
  • 4.2 用户体验与稳定性保障

  • 防御性编程:输入验证与异常处理降低崩溃风险。
  • 文档完整性:提供安装指南、API说明及故障排查手册。
  • 4.3 排名影响因素与优化方向

    优化软件排行榜单更新与性能提升实用技巧解析

    优化软件排行中,以下策略可提升可见性:

  • 关键词优化:在元标签与文档中嵌入高频搜索词(如“性能优化工具”)。
  • 用户评价管理:鼓励正面评论并及时修复漏洞。
  • 版本迭代透明度:公开更新日志以增强信任度。
  • 结论

    优化软件的选择与配置需综合性能需求、硬件条件及应用场景。通过系统化调优与策略部署,可显著提升其在专业排行中的竞争力。未来,随着AI驱动的自动化优化工具兴起,开发者需持续关注技术趋势,以保持领先地位。

    附录

  • 工具推荐:Grammarly(文档校对)、Apifox(接口管理)。
  • 扩展阅读:《软件架构设计文档模板》、ASO优化指南。
  • 本文共计约210,涵盖优化软件的核心分类、操作指南及配置策略,并通过三次提及“优化软件排行”突出主题,引用来源覆盖性能优化、代码重构及排名策略等多领域,符合技术文档规范。

    相关文章:

    文章已关闭评论!